Athens Today: September 14

Wednesday, Hump Day!

1. Big kids (ages 6-10) might enjoy “DIY Craft” hour at today at 4pm, where they can learn all sorts of cool crafting techniques. Bigger kids (ages 8-14) can enjoy the new Thursday Night Craft Club series, starting tomorrow from 4pm-6pm. This series, taught by Hope Hilton, will explore Printmaking methods such as screen printing, relief printing and more.

2. The folks at Athens Food Tours are planning a Fall Bicycle Farm Tour. This 35-mile ride will take place Saturday, October 15, 2011 in Madison, GA, from 8:30am-noon. To sign up call 706-338-8054.

3. The State Botanical Gardens of Georgia Gold Medal Plant Symposium and Sale take place today. The Symposium, which begins at 8:30am, will entail a book signing and raffle, as well as guest speakers Wilf Nicholls, director of the garden, Matthew Chappell of cooperative extension, Vince Dooley, former UGA football coach and athletic director, and Rita Randolph of Randolph Greehouses. The Plant Sale will take place from 10am-4pm.

4. The offers Wildcard Wednesday as an opportunity for teens (11-18) to meet and participate in fun projects and crafts after school. Today at 4pm, learn how to make fabric beads. If you have some cool fabric scraps, bring them in to share.

5. The Georgia Climate Change Coalition will host a viewing party at for the 7pm-8pm segment of the “24 Hours of Reality” multimedia presentation by Al Gore. The presentation will represent every time zone around the globe, and will be broadcast once per hour for 24 hours in an attempt to show the reality of our climate crisis. Tonight’s event begins at 6:30pm, with live streaming at 7pm.
